Golden Triangle Tour

Golden Triangle Tour is the most traversed circuit n India where you can catch the glimpses of heritage, culture and historical monuments of India. The golden triangle travel packages include the sightseeing of three major destinations that lies on Indian Map in a triangular form. The trio cities are- Delhi, Agra and Jaipur.

Delhi: The national capital

Delhi is the national capital of India which is divided into two parts- New Delhi and Old Delhi. The major tourist places to be explored in Old Delhi are- Red Fort, Jama Masjid, Chandni Chowk and Raj Ghat. Whereas, in New Delhi, explore Humayun’s Tomb, Qutub Minar, Lotus Temple and India Gate. Agra: The Taj city

Agra is known as the Taj City since a popular historical monument is located in Agra. Explore Taj Mahal and click the stunning pictures during the sunrise or sunset to get a perfect view. Other attractions to be explored within Delhi Jaipur Agra tour are- Agra Fort, Mehtab Garden and Tomb of Itmad-ud-Daulah. Don’t forget to have famous Agra ka Petha in desserts.

Jaipur: The pink city

The last destination of India triangle tour is Jaipur which is known for rich heritage, culture, splendid forts and colorful bazaar of Rajasthan. The tourist places not be missed in Jaipur are- Hawa Mahal, Amber Fort, Jal Mahal, City Palace and Jantar Mantar. Explore the local shops to buy handicrafts, puppets, lac bangles, bandhani fabrics, mojdis etc.

Best time to visit
Between the months of November and March, the trip can be planned. During this time, the weather is pleasant for exploration of trio cities. In summers, it is suggested to avoid due to the scorching heat throughout India which makes sightseeing unpleasant.
